On average across the year,
no, Ohio, United States is not hotter than
Beaumont, Texas
.
Ohio, United States has an average temperature of 11°C/52°F and Beaumont, Texas has an average temperature of 21°C/70°F.
Ohio, United States's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F, which is not hotter than Beaumont, Texas's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 34°C/93°F).
On average across the year, yes, Ohio, United States is colder than Beaumont, Texas . Ohio, United States has an average minimum temperature of 6°C/43°F and Beaumont, Texas has an average minimum temperature of 16°C/61°F.
On average across the year,
no, Ohio, United States has less rain than
Beaumont, Texas. Ohio, United States has an average annual rainfall of 1245mm and Beaumont, Texas has an average annual rainfall of 1917mm.
Ohio, United States's wettest month is June, with an average monthly rainfall of 132mm, which is drier than Beaumont, Texas's wettest month (August, with an average monthly rainfall of 268mm).
